ITEM SUMMARY:

 

                     This Resolution will authorize the Collin County Elections Administrator to conduct the City of McKinney Special Election to be held on Saturday, May 2, 2020.

 

                     The following services will be provided by the County: retention, training and compensation of election workers; election equipment, supplies and tabulation of election results; conduct joint early voting by mail and in person; and joint election day voting.

 

                     The City will be responsible for the following: calling the May 2, 2020 Election (completed January 21, 2020); posting and publication of the election notices; and official canvass of the election results.

 

                     This Resolution also authorizes a Joint Election Agreement for the May 2, 2020 Elections of City of McKinney, McKinney Independent School and Collin College, and other governing bodies within Collin County.

 

                     The Joint Election Agreement will allow for shared costs associated with the holding of this election.

 

                     Election Day Voting will be conducted 7 a.m. to 7 p.m. on Saturday, May 2, 2020.

FINANCIAL SUMMARY:

 

                     The City’s cost for this Election will be approximately $70,000, which includes the contract with Collin County Elections Administrator to conduct the City Council General Election, translation, voter’s guide, advertisement, and legal notices.

 

                     This cost is subject to change should any of the contracting entities cancel their election.
